Could THS8200 support BT 1120 input ?

Other Parts Discussed in Thread: THS8200

The BT 1120 is similar with SMTPE 274M . I want to know that THS8200 can support BT.1120 1080p 30fps YCbCr 4:2:2 input to convert them YPbPr output ?

 

 

  • Yes, the THS8200 does support BT.1120 1080p-30Hz.  The setup will be similar to 1080p-60Hz, but the pixel rate and clock will be 74.25MPPS instead of 148.5MPPS.

    In general, BT.1120 with embedded syncs is supported by setting the input format to 20bit YCbCr 4:2:2, enabling the 4:2:2 > 4:4:4 interpolation filter, and enabling embedded EAV/SAV sync operation.  Other settings such as pixels per line, lines per frame/field, dtg_spec_x horizontal timing, and output sync amplitudes must be uniquely set depending on input format.
